Transaction 67ce653577077d8c23d7bbbb750ccca3718fa6c667621448e30b0cefb749653f

1 Input
2 Outputs
  • 67ce653577077d8c23d7bbbb750ccca3718fa6c667621448e30b0cefb749653f:0
  • value  297949364
    address  2MseKhgNX9N4P4SKjFtjXV7yBBqzHKiyV7p
  • 67ce653577077d8c23d7bbbb750ccca3718fa6c667621448e30b0cefb749653f:1
  • value  3827833
    address  2Mz2E84sokdC5Hb8WGoFrAozoFuyCwomge3